NEW MEXICO PRESCRIPTION DRUG ASSISTANCE PROGRAM

   
Information provided by: the New Mexico Aging & Long-Term Services Department

The New Mexico Prescription Drug Assistance Program (PDA) can assist people of any age who live in New Mexico and do not have prescription drug coverage, or have used their benefits. Each drug company has it's own guidelines for eligibility, but usually patients must be low to middle income, need medications to treat long-term conditions, have no insurance to pay for the drugs, and be ineligible for, and not enrolled in, other types of assistance programs.
